Product description

Experience a taste of Ancient Egypt with this historical cookbook. Sample the flavours of date balls, chicken kebabs and stuffed cabbage leaves! Packed with delicious recipes and intriguing facts, this book explores history by looking at how people ate. It covers farming and fishing, mealtimes, kitchen life, cooking methods, festival foods, medicinal foods and much more.
